Decorative Painting Overview
Instructor: Linda Brescia - Bio

This course will provide the student with basic skills using common tools and methods in the art of Decorative Painting. Through professional demonstration, class discussion, and hands on exercises, the student will produce sample finishes that can be executed on surfaces of their choice. Painting techniques include brush strokes, glazing, texturing, and layering. Patterning, color, and composition will be discussed, and applied to work. Exercises will be done on sample boards, leaving the student with the beginning of a decorative painting resource library.

Color Mixing
Instructor: Linda Brescia - Bio

This full one day, content rich, hands on color mixing workshop is for anyone interested in increasing their color mixing skills dramatically, or learning how to do it the first time. The student will learn how to work with a limited palette of pigments utilizing a scientific process, to mix any color with ease, each and every time. If you can name it, you can make it. Amazingly, by the end of the session, color mixing will now become a thoughtful, and controlled thinking process. Visual Relationships
Instructor: Linda Brescia - Bio

Bring your art making to a new level. In this interactive class, the students will create an inspirational journal using magazine clippings, fabrics, decorative papers etc, to use as a learning tool to explore “seeing” their environment as an artist does. While creating this body of work, the students will begin training their eyes to identify basic design elements and principles at work, as well as understanding basic color combinations that are visually appealing. Anyone interested in learning a refreshing new way to interpret their visual surroundings, and apply them to their own artwork, especially scrap booking, would enjoy this offering.

Basic Drawing
Instructor: Suzanne Ahrern - Bio

Drawing skills are fundamental to the artist’s visual education. With the assistance of the instructor, the students will begin to see the environment around them with a keener eye. As their powers of observation sharpen, they will learn to translate what they see into drawings. Concepts that will be explored are line, form, value, proportion, perspective, and composition.
